Occupational disease. Problems of risk assessment.
Clinics in Laboratory Medicine
|September 1, 1984
Summary
This study examines occupational health risk assessment, detailing how risk estimates are generated and managed. It uses benzene exposure as a case study to illustrate the risk assessment process.
